The operating cycle is the inventory conversion period plus the accounts receivable period.
Campaign Funds
Money raised and spent to finance political campaigns, including the promotion of candidates, policies, or initiatives.
Corporate Contributions
Financial or material support provided by businesses to political campaigns, charitable organizations, or community projects.
Campaign Finance
The funds that are raised and spent to promote candidates, political parties, or policy initiatives in election contexts.
Democide
The murder of any person or people by their government, including genocide, politicide, and mass murder.
